Vincennes Posted June 20, 2019 Share #1 Posted June 20, 2019 A while back I purchased a collection of WW2 aerial photos. In the collection were 22 photos 5"x6.5" in size taken by the 312th. Bomb Group over the Philippines. 16 are identified by the text at the bottom of the photo for location and Bomb Group, etc. But that text has been trimmed off 6 of the photos. Since they are the same size as the others I assume they were also taken by the 312th Bomb Group in the Philippines. Here I will show the original photos at 150 dpi and an enlargement of a camouflaged aircraft from that photo at 600 dpi (4X enlargement). The enlargements are not of the best quality but hopefully they will help. On the first photo and enlargement you can see an aircraft enclosed by embankments on 3 sides.
